Basic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al finishing is essential for a pleasing appearance as well as clean-room situations. It really is among the most widely used solutions simply because of its use in enhancing the overall beauty of the product, such as, motorcycle parts, cookware or vehicle parts. Besides that, lots of clean-rooms require a shiny finish as a way to reduce the perviousness of the material which often can result in debris to build up and contaminate. An instance of this implementation could be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ll discover a number of different ways to polish metals, and we will look into the various procedures required. Various metals can be finished utilising chemicals, electromechanically, with specialized buffing machines, or simply by hand. A buffing paste or compound may be applied, that can contain ch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its quite high viscosity is just about the time intensive. In contrast, things made of non-ferrous metals are generally more receptive to buffing, mainly because these need the lowest number of operations.

A slower pad speed must be used if a top quality mirror finish is crucial. Polishing buffs bedaubed with paste will be enormously impacted by the forces on the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a specified range, although overreaching the maximum degree of pressure not merely cuts down on the quality of treatment, but additionally worsens effectiveness, causes wear on the part, and furthermore a conspicuous heating up of the work-pieces, as a result of friction. When you are working on thin items, it's raised heat (and a relating pliability of the material) that causes items to twist, flex, or bend. As a rule, it will take a competent technician to factor in each one of these things to equally prevent harm to the metal part and to work efficiently. In order to significantly enhance the standard of the finished surface, the buffing action must really be done with a lot less aggression and not so much pressure in order to ultimately deliver a surface area devoid of scratches or marks brought about by the polishing procedure, therefore arriving at a polished mirror finish.
